Common Management Challenges in the Aviation Industry

As the aviation industry continues to evolve, managers face a myriad of challenges that can significantly impact operational efficiency, service quality, and regulatory compliance. Addressing these issues with precision and strategic foresight is crucial for maintaining a competitive edge.

1. Navigating Regulatory Compliance

Aviation is one of the most heavily regulated industries, and managers must ensure their operations meet a complex web of international and domestic regulations. Non-compliance can lead to severe penalties, reputational damage, and operational delays.

- Issue: Constantly evolving safety and environmental regulations require continuous monitoring and adaptation.

- Impact: Failure to comply can result in costly fines and grounding of flights, directly affecting profitability and customer trust.

- Solution: Implementing robust compliance management systems and investing in staff training on the latest regulatory updates.

2. Workforce Management and Retention

The aviation industry is critically dependent on a skilled workforce, yet it faces significant challenges in attracting and retaining talent, especially pilots and technical staff.

- Issue: High turnover rates and the retirement of experienced personnel create workforce gaps.

- Impact: Loss of experienced staff reduces operational efficiency and increases training costs for new hires.

- Solution: Develop competitive compensation packages, promote career development opportunities, and foster a positive work culture.

3. Enhancing Operational Efficiency

To remain competitive, aviation managers must constantly seek ways to improve operational efficiency, whether in flight operations, maintenance, or ground services.

- Issue: Inefficient processes can lead to increased costs and longer turnaround times.

- Impact: Higher operational costs and delays affect customer satisfaction and airline profitability.

- Solution: Invest in cutting-edge technology such as predictive maintenance and streamlined check-in procedures to minimize downtime and enhance passenger experience.

4. Managing Technological Integration

The rapid pace of technological advancement presents both opportunities and challenges for aviation managers striving to stay at the cutting edge.

- Issue: Integrating new technologies like AI and IoT can be complex and costly.

- Impact: Poor integration can lead to operational disruptions and security vulnerabilities.

- Solution: Develop a clear technological roadmap, allocate sufficient resources for implementation, and engage with experts to ensure seamless integration.

5. Addressing Environmental Concerns

The aviation industry's environmental impact is under increasing scrutiny, with pressure to reduce carbon emissions and adopt sustainable practices.

- Issue: Balancing environmental responsibility with profitability.

- Impact: Non-compliance with environmental standards can lead to regulatory penalties and loss of customer goodwill.

- Solution: Invest in fuel-efficient aircraft, explore alternative fuels, and implement effective carbon offset programs, demonstrating commitment to sustainability.

Recognizing and adeptly handling these challenges is essential for aviation managers aiming to lead their organizations to success in a demanding and ever-changing industry landscape.

Glossary and terms

Glossary of KanBo Terminology

Introduction

KanBo is a comprehensive work management platform designed to optimize project organization, task delegation, and document management through a hierarchy of workspaces, spaces, and cards. This glossary serves as a fact sheet of key terms and concepts within KanBo, offering insights into its user management, space and card management, and various visualization options that bolster productivity and track project progression.

Core Concepts & Navigation

- KanBo Hierarchy: The structured layer of organization in KanBo, consisting of workspaces at the top, encapsulating spaces, which in turn hold cards. This dimensional structure aids in project and task management.

- Spaces: The central location or "collections of cards” where activities or tasks are organized and executed. Spaces provide a versatile top bar and content views for card display.

- Cards: The fundamental task units within KanBo, representing specific work items or objectives.

- MySpace: A personal dashboard for users to aggregate and manage cards from across the KanBo platform using "mirror cards".

- Space Views: Different formats to visualize spaces including Kanban, List, Table, Calendar, and Mind Map views, with advanced options like Time Chart, Forecast Chart, and Workload views (upcoming).

User Management

- KanBo Users: Individuals with roles and permissions structured within the platform, managed distinctly per space.

- User Activity Stream: A historical log of user actions within spaces, providing insight into user interaction and activity history.

- Access Levels: Defines user permissions within workspaces and spaces, such as owner, member, and visitor (with visitor having the least access).

- Deactivated Users: Users who are no longer active in KanBo but whose past contributions remain visible.

- Mentions: A feature to tag users with the "@" symbol within comments and chat to draw attention to that task or discussion.

Workspace and Space Management

- Workspaces: Overarching containers for spaces which provide a broader organizational framework.

- Workspace Types: Various workspace formats including private and standard options for localized environments.

- Space Types: Designations such as "Standard," "Private," or "Shared," determine privacy and user invite capabilities.

- Folders: Tools for organizing workspaces, with removal moving spaces up in structure.

- Space Templates: Pre-configured templates for creating spaces with specific setups. Restricted to users with specific roles.

- Deleting Spaces: Requires being a space user to even access the space for potential deletion.

Card Management

- Card Structure: The setup and organization of cards as the primary project elements within KanBo.

- Card Grouping: Refers to organizing cards by categories like due dates or specific spaces.

- Mirror Cards: Cards displayed in MySpace that are actually located in other spaces, facilitating task oversight.

- Card Relations: Linking cards to form hierarchical relationships; executively utilized in Mind Map views.

- Card Blockers: Tools to manage task interdependencies, administered by users with specific permissions.

Document Management

- Card Documents: References to external files linked to cards, reflective across all associated cards upon modification.

- Space Documents: Pertains to all files linked within a space, stored in a default document library unique to each space.

Searching and Filtering

- KanBo Search: An encompassing search tool enabling users to locate cards, comments, documents, and more, within specified scopes.

- Filtering Cards: The mechanism to sieve through cards using different criteria for efficient management.

Reporting & Visualization

- Activity Streams: Logs tracing activities within users or spaces to give a comprehensive action history.

- Forecast Chart View: A feature projecting future project progress based on existing data nuances.

- Gantt Chart View: A chronological bar-chart representation of time-dependent tasks, ideal for strategic planning.

Key Considerations

- Permissions: Access and functionality are determined by a user’s role and permissions within the system.

- Customization: KanBo provides flexibility with customization via custom fields, space views, and templates.

- Integration: Seamless integration with external document libraries like SharePoint enhances KanBo capabilities.

This glossary encapsulates the primary terms users will encounter on KanBo, providing a foundational understanding for effective usage and exploration of the platform’s capabilities.
